Participants will be presented with a series of diagnostically challenging neuroimaging cases and, for each case, have the opportunity to vote on a correct answer using an audience response system. This will be followed by a detailed explanation of the correct answer and additional high-yield teaching points related to the imaging findings. Participants should increase their familiarity with common and less common imaging abnormalities.
